For a haploid fungus, the starting point in the biosynthesis of the amino acid arginine is Compound X, which is always present in and absorbed from the environment. The arginine biosynthetic pathway is: Compound X- Enzyme A Compound Y- Enzyme B Enzyme C Compound Z- Arginine It is know that genes encoding enzymes A and C are on two different chromosomes. A mutant strain of genotype a (lacking only enzyme A) is crossed to a mutant strain of genotype c (lacking only enzyme C) to generate a diploid strain. Sporulation (i.e. meiosis) is subsequently induced in the resulting diploid strain. What proportion of the spores (haploids formed by sporulation) is expected to grow on medium without arginine but supplemented with Compound Y? 100% 50% S 0% 25%
